The National Association of Nigerian Nurses in North America (NANNNA) is a united organization of Nigerian Nurses in North America working to improve the health and quality of lives of Nigerians at home and abroad.
California NANNNA (CA-NANNNA) supports the efforts of the national organization through coordination of the activities of California State nurses dedicated NANNNA’s vision and mission.
